Blinken meets with Netanyahu in Israel

The United States will make "significant contributions" to rebuilding Gaza which will be announced later Tuesday, US Secretary of State Antony Blinken said in Jerusalem after meeting with Israel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u. CNN's Hadas Gold reports.

Lumbermen work on the felling of eight 230 years old Sessile oak trees selected the week before to be used in the reconstruction of Notre-Dame de Paris Cathedral in the Foret de Berce, near Jupilles, on March 8, 2021. - A total of 1000 oaks are due to be hacked down by the end of March to rebuild the spire and roof of the cathedral, which was ravaged by fire in April 2019. Oaks from every region of France are being used to rebuild the cherished national monument, around half from state land and the rest from private donations.
